How they compare

Georgia currently reports 0.1583 t per square kilometre against 0.1133 t per square kilometre in Cambodia, a difference of 0.045 t per square kilometre.

That makes Georgia's figure about 1.4 times Cambodia's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 21 shared years of data; in 2003 it was Cambodia ahead.

Cambodia ranks 91st and Georgia ranks 89th of 125 countries.

Georgia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
